AllPoints 00-975882 Technical Specs
The AllPoints 00-975882 impact sensor operates on a control voltage typically compatible with 24V systems, with a power consumption profile suitable for continuous operation. Its construction features corrosion-resistant materials ensuring performance in high-moisture environments. The sensor’s dimensions of 1.95 inches in width, 1.25 inches in height, and 5.6 inches in depth facilitate straightforward integration into various equipment enclosures. Weighing approximately 0.18 lbs, it is lightweight yet robust enough to withstand repetitive impact cycles. Designed for OEM applications, its impact detection mechanism delivers precise activation in high-efficiency food processing lines. The device’s environmental resistance supports reliable functioning across typical kitchen temperature ranges, while its straightforward disassembly allows for easy cleaning and maintenance in busy foodservice operations. The impact sensor is non-hazardous and suitable for prolonged use without degradation.
- Electrical Requirements: 24V control voltage, low power draw
- Construction & Finish: Corrosion-resistant plastics & metals
- Dimensions: 1.95" W x 1.25" H x 5.6" D
- Weight: 0.18 lbs (product weight)
- Impact detection type: Mechanical contact sensor for accurate impact sensing
- Installation: Surface-mounted with straightforward wiring for quick setup
- Operational environment: Suitable for high-moisture and temperature-variable settings
